Uncovering the Israeli-Palestinian Conflict: An In-depth Analysis

The conflict between Israelis and Palestinians is multifaceted, with both sides having competing claims to the same land. The Israeli government has long maintained its right to the territory, citing historical and biblical ties, while the Palestinians argue that they have been displaced and denied their rightful homeland. This fundamental disagreement has been at the heart of the conflict for decades, with periods of relative calm punctuated by outbreaks of violence.

Several recent developments have contributed to the current explosion of violence. One major factor has been the Gaza Strip crisis, where Palestinians have faced significant economic hardship and restrictions on their movement. The situation in Gaza has been particularly dire, with high levels of unemployment, poverty, and limited access to basic necessities like electricity and water.

Another significant factor has been the Israeli government's policies regarding settlements and territorial expansion. The construction of new settlements in the West Bank has been a major point of contention, as it is seen by many as an attempt to consolidate Israeli control over the territory and undermine the prospects for a two-state solution.

External actors have also played a significant role in the current crisis. The United States, in particular, has been accused of contributing to the escalation of tensions through its recognition of Jerusalem as Israel's capital. This move was seen as a significant departure from previous US policy, which had maintained that the status of Jerusalem should be determined through negotiations between the parties.

The international community has also been criticized for its response to the crisis. While many countries have called for restraint and a return to negotiations, others have been accused of taking sides or failing to provide adequate support to the Palestinians. The United Nations has played a key role in attempting to broker a peace agreement, but its efforts have been hindered by the lack of progress on the ground.
